This gets murkier by the minute!
It seems that Cheerios are NOT made by Nestle in the USA or Canada,
but ARE made by them in other countries. I believe that this is true
of some other products too - in some countries they are made by Nestle
but not in others.
Then there is the whole licence thing.
Some sweets in the USA, for example, are made by Hershey - but under
licence from Nestle! Where do you draw the line?

My husband is convinced that Nestle will soon have such a monopoly
that we won't be able to buy anything at all!

>Cereal Partners Worldwide S.A. is a joint venture between General
Mills and Nestlé, established in 1990 to produce breakfast cereals.
The company is headquartered in Lausanne, Switzerland, and markets
cereals in more than 130 countries (except for the U.S. and Canada).
The company's cereals are sold under the Nestlé brand, although many
originated from General Mills and some such as Shredded Wheat and
Shreddies were once made by Nabisco. <
